Zonz race is off and under way

The hunt for Steve N'Zonzi is well under way with a fairly substantial amount of clubs chasing him.

Zonz has been frozen out at Rovers under Steve Kean and is naturally (like a lot of the first team players) looking for a route back to the Premier League after Rovers dropped to the Championship.

Arsenal, Chelsea, Newcastle, Everton, Liverpool, Spurs, Sunderland and Fulham have all been credited with an interest in one of the few Rovers players that IS likely to attract a fairly large transfer fee given his age, ability and experience.

Given the size of the interest Steve is likely to fetch in the region of £7 million and given a better side to play in he would look vastly improved to the stroppy child we saw late on in his Rovers career.

Nailed on to leave the club this summer.
